Natural Substrates/ Products (Substrates)

EC Number Natural Substrates Organism Comment (Nat. Sub.) Natural Products Comment (Nat. Pro.) Rev. Reac.
1.14.11.51 N6-methyladenine in DNA + 2-oxoglutarate + O2 Mus musculus the enzyme catalyses oxidative demethylation of DNA N6-methyladenine, a prevalent modification in LINE-1 transposons adenine in DNA + formaldehyde + succinate + CO2
